AC Not Cooling? Why It Runs but Won't Cool the House
On a hot Orange County afternoon, an air conditioner that runs but won't cool is more than an annoyance. The system moving air tells you the blower works — it says nothing about whether heat is actually being removed. Start at the Thermostat
Set it to COOL and AUTO (not ON — ON runs the fan continuously and blows room-temperature air between cooling cycles, which feels like "warm air"). Drop the setpoint several degrees below the room temperature and listen for the outdoor unit to start. If the screen is blank, replace the thermostat batteries.
The Air Filter — the Most Common Cause
A clogged filter starves the system of airflow. Cooling drops, and worse, the evaporator coil can get so cold it freezes into a block of ice — at which point almost no air comes through. Check the filter first; if it's gray with dust, replace it. If you find ice on the indoor coil or the refrigerant lines, switch the system to FAN ONLY and let it thaw completely (often a few hours) before running cooling again.
The Outdoor Condenser Unit
The outdoor unit dumps your home's heat outside. If its coil is packed with dust, grass, or cottonwood, it can't release heat and cooling collapses — especially on the hottest days when it matters most. With the power off at the disconnect, gently rinse the outer fins with a hose from the inside out, and clear at least two feet of space around the unit. Never use a pressure washer — the fins bend easily.
Airflow Inside
Make sure return and supply vents are open and unblocked by furniture or rugs. A blower motor that's weak or failing reduces airflow the same way a dirty filter does, and contributes to coil freezing.
Causes That Need a Technician
- Failed run capacitor. A very common failure in our summer heat — the capacitor gives the compressor and fan motor their starting jolt. When it fails you may hear a hum or a click with no start, and no cooling. It's a frequent, fixable cause.
- Low refrigerant / leak. Refrigerant doesn't get consumed — low charge means a leak. Signs are weak cooling, ice on the lines, or a hissing sound. It requires leak detection, repair, and a proper recharge by an EPA-certified tech.
- Contactor and controls. The contactor is the relay that powers the outdoor unit; pitted contacts stop the unit from starting.
- Compressor. The heart of the system. A compressor that won't start (often downstream of a bad capacitor or contactor) means no cooling at all.
- Condensate safety switch. If the drain backs up, a float switch shuts cooling off to prevent water damage — clearing the drain restores it.
Safety and Smart Limits
Don't run a frozen or hard-locked system repeatedly — short-cycling a struggling compressor can turn a small repair into a replacement. If the breaker trips more than once, stop and call; a repeatedly tripping AC circuit is an electrical fault, not something to keep resetting.
What We Do When We Arrive
We check airflow and the coils, then test the electrical heart of the system — capacitor, contactor, and compressor — and measure the refrigerant charge to find leaks rather than just topping off. That means we fix the actual cause and get your house cold again, instead of masking it.
